The Studiopress Jessica WordPress Theme functions as a highly adaptable Genesis child theme designed specifically to bridge the gap between aesthetic design and store functionality. It provides a foundational structure that supports multiple e-commerce solutions, allowing developers and store managers to select the plugin environment that best matches their inventory and checkout requirements.
This theme caters specifically to those who need a widget-heavy homepage structure where content placement is determined by the site owner rather than a rigid, hard-coded layout. By leveraging the power of the Genesis Framework, it maintains a clean codebase while offering the necessary hooks for store owners to integrate their preferred shopping carts and product management tools.
Plugin-agnostic commerce architecture allows store managers to choose between multiple popular e-commerce engines like WooCommerce, WP e-Commerce, and iThemes Exchange depending on project requirements.
Fully widgetized homepage templates provide granular control over the placement of featured products, promotional banners, and custom content blocks without requiring complex page builder configurations.
Integrated mobile responsive framework ensures that the storefront layout automatically adjusts to different screen sizes and devices to maintain usability for mobile shoppers.
Customizable navigation menus enable the addition of specific CSS classes directly within the WordPress dashboard for styling elements like shopping cart icons or “last item” visual indicators.
Pre-styled shop components come ready for deployment, covering essential elements such as free shipping indicators, customer rating displays, and organized product categories.
Multiple sidebars and layout options offer the ability to toggle between full-width, content-sidebar, or sidebar-content configurations on a per-page or per-post basis.

Pros:
Offers genuine flexibility by not forcing a single e-commerce plugin on the user.
Utilizes a highly modular widget system for the homepage, making layout changes straightforward.
Includes clear configuration instructions and PSD elements, which is helpful for developers.
Cons:
The setup process relies on manual configuration and XML imports, which can be time-consuming compared to modern one-click demo installers.
The reliance on older e-commerce plugins might require extra maintenance for modern store requirements.
The theme was originally built on the Genesis framework’s traditional widgetized architecture, so native drag-and-drop page builder support is Not Clearly Specified. You can attempt to use third-party page builders, but you may need to adjust the CSS to ensure they interact correctly with the pre-styled Genesis templates.
Purchasing the theme usually provides the child theme files, but whether the base Genesis Framework is included depends on the specific marketplace or vendor where you acquire the license. You should verify the package contents on the checkout page before finalizing your purchase to ensure you have the required framework.
While the theme is designed to be compatible with multiple platforms, attempting to run multiple e-commerce plugins simultaneously is generally discouraged. You should select the single solution that best fits your inventory needs to avoid software conflicts and database bloat.
You can upload a custom logo image directly through the theme settings menu in the WordPress dashboard. If you prefer a text-based logo, the theme settings also support toggling between an image file or site title text.
Compatibility depends entirely on the specific plugin you are using. Because this is a standard Genesis child theme, it follows WordPress coding standards, though specific plugin integrations that require unique template overrides may need custom coding.
